On the matter of mortgages. We took out a 'new immigrant' type mortgage under Scotiabanks 'start-right' program. They required us to put down 35% and to prove in addition that we had 2 years mortgage payments to hand, which was quickly accounted for by us once we were in the house and started setting up in country
There were no added extras over and above that for us being new to Canada.
